Rationale: reproducible builds, license auditing, and no outbound fetches from CI. The mirror lives behind the Fenwick proxy and only accepts signed pulls from the `fontsync` service account. Never commit font binaries directly; run `fontsync pull` and let the lockfile track hashes. License review is handled by the Bramleigh tooling team before any family lands in the mirror. Authenticate fontsync against Glyphvault with the key below.

service key, fawip-bajef: kto11_Qt5wZK9vdNC

Dependency pinning policy — read before your first build.

At Marleton Systems, all dependencies in the Driftgate codebase are pinned to exact versions. If a build fails with a resolution error, do not loosen the pin; check whether the internal mirror has synced the version. Upgrades go through the scheduled bump pipeline with a review from the platform group. To query the mirror's sync status endpoint, authenticate with the bearer token below.

login token, bagug-kafop: eyJhbGciOiJIUzI1NiIsInR5cCI6IkpXVCJ9.eyJzdWIiOiIcMLov2In0.Z5RLDIfp

Hi all, welcome aboard at Quillbrook! Quick note from the front desk about the wellness room on level 3. It's first come, first served unless you've booked it through the Restio app, so do check the schedule before settling in. Sessions are capped at 45 minutes during busy hours. The door stays locked between bookings to keep it tidy and quiet. When your slot starts, let yourself in with the entry code below.

staff pass of kagef-yahip = bdg-TKELFT-63915354